Rental yields = (annual rent / property price) x 100. Aim 6%+ net after voids/mortgage. 2026 forecasts: North dominates post-2025 dip, thanks to jobs, unis, transport links.

Top Cities Ranked by Yield: The Hot List

Data crunches (Zoopla/Rightmove 2026 est.) spotlight North/North East. Low buys (£100k-£200k), rents £700-£1k pcm.

  1. Hull: 9-11%. £120k 2-bed, £650 pcm. Uni boom, Humber regen.
  2. Liverpool: 8-10%. £150k, £800 pcm. Student hordes, docks revival.
  3. Bradford: 8-9.5%. £110k, £600 pcm. Affordable, transport links.
  4. Sunderland: 8-9%. £130k, £650 pcm. Stable renters.
  5. Middlesbrough: 8-9%. £100k, £550 pcm. Working class demand.
  6. Nottingham: 7.5-9%. £180k, £900 pcm. Top student city.
  7. Leeds: 7-8.5%. £200k, £1k pcm. Jobs galore.
  8. Sheffield: 7-8.5%. £160k, £800 pcm. Unis, steel revival.
  9. Manchester: 7-8.5%. £220k, £1.1k pcm. MediaCity magic.
  10. Newcastle: 6.5-8%. £170k, £850 pcm. Geordie nights fuel lets.

Scotland/Wales: Glasgow/Cardiff 6.5-8%.

London? 4-5% growth over yield.
